Executive Summary & Key Takeaways

**Summary:** Government of India, Directorate General of Health Services, Central Drugs Standard Control Organisation, Medical Devices and Diagnostics Division issued Notice No. 29Misc032019DC 134, dated 4 9 [Date is incomplete in the original document, thus retained as is]. The notice concerns the submission of notarized apostilled documents for the import of medical devices and in-vitro diagnostic kits. Due to representations received and the ongoing COVID-19 situation, the effective date of order F.No. 29Misc032019DC60 dated 23.04.2020, regarding the aforementioned document submission requirements, is extended for a period of four months or until the normalization of the COVID-19 situation, whichever occurs earlier. The notice was issued from FDA Bhawan, Kotla Road, New Delhi-110002.

No. 29/Misc/03/2019-DC (134) Government of India Directorate General of Health Services Central Drugs Standard Control Organisation (Medical Devices and Diagnostics Division) FDA Bhawan, Kotla Road, New Delhi-110002. In light of representations received and COVID-19 situation, the effective date of the even number order F.No. 29/Misc/03/2019-DC(60) dated 23.04.2020 issued on the subject cited above, is further extended upto 4 months or till normalization of the situation in light of CoVID-19 whichever is earlier.
